- Glass ceilings are the artificial barriers that deny women and minorities the opportunity to advance within their careers inmotionmagazine.com
- Example sentence(s)
- Even before The Wall Street Journal coined the term "glass ceiling" 20 years ago, researchers debated why women seldom reach the highest ranks in business. - Forbes.com
- "Although we weren't able to shatter that highest, hardest glass ceiling this time, it's got about 18 million cracks in it," Hillary Clinton told a huge rally of supporters at the National Building Museum in Washington. - smh.com.au
- The potential is there for women to achieve an equal footing with men, but the social mores and male attitudes make an effective barrier to women rising above a certain point; this tendency brings to mind a glass ceiling. - Feminism and Women's Studies
